Keep your protein intake high to increase muscle mass. Protein provides the building blocks that create muscles. Lack of protein makes increasing muscle mass difficult. Try to eat healthy, lean proteins in two of the three major meals and one or two of your snacks every day.

Train opposite muscles, such as chest and back or the quads and hamstrings, in the same session. This gives one muscle group a break while you work the opposite and also ensures that you don’t train unevenly and create muscle imbalances. This will allow you to bump up your workout intensity and you won’t have to be in the gym as long.

Try adding plyometric exercises to your workout regimen. Plyometric exercises target fast-twitch muscle tissue, encouraging faster muscle growth. Plyometrics are considered ballistic moves in that they require a certain amount of acceleration. When completing plyometric push-ups, for example, you would remove your hands from the floor, pushing your body upward as high as you can.

Pre-exhausting muscles is a great way to build the most stubborn groups. Biceps can tire out before your lats when you’re performing rows, for example. When you complete isolation exercises you help fix this, do things like straight-arm pulldowns which don’t necessarily concentrate on your biceps to complete. Exhausting your lats before doing rows will even out your muscle use and allow you to use your biceps to exhaustion.

Try consuming a lot of protein rich foods right before and after exercising in order to increase muscle mass. A good measure is to take in 15 grams of protein before you train and another 15 grams of protein after your workout is completed. This is the same amount of protein contained in a glass or two of milk.
